O'Donnell's Oxford (latest)
Politico ^ | 9/30/10 | Ben Smith

Posted on 09/30/2010 9:06:53 AM PDT by pissant

Christine O'Donnell has denied that she created the LinkedIn profile that said she went to Oxford.

Now the DNC is circulating another online resume for her making the same claim, this one with a "user verified" tag.

The resume isn't a carbon copy of the LinkedIn profile, but it does give her a "Certificate , Post Modernism in the New Millennium, University of Oxford."

Snarks DNC national press secretary Hari Sevugan: "Apparently they don't teach Google at the Fake Oxford University."
